OpenJDK是Java开发平台的免费版本。OpenJDK项目由许多组件组成。这些主要是HotSpot(虚拟机),Java类库和javac Java编译器。作为Oracle Java一部分的Web浏览器插件和Web Start不包含在OpenJDK中。Sun先前曾表示他们将尝试开源这些组件,但是Sun和Oracle都没有这样做。IcedTea提供了当前唯一可用的免费插件和Web Start实现。支持的JDK版本OpenJDK最初仅基于Java平台的JDK 7版本。有几个单独的OpenJDK项目:-OpenJDK 8项目(),它将是JDK 8的基础。-OpenJDK 7u项目(),它基于JDK 7,并且对现有Java 7版本进行更新。-基于JDK 7的OpenJDK 6项目(),经过改装以提供Java 6的开源版本。
特征
分类目录
具有任何许可的所有平台的OpenJDK替代品

582
Java
Java是一种通用的计算机编程语言,它是并发的,基于类的,面向对象的,专门设计为具有尽可能少的实现依赖性。

3
Oracle JDeveloper
Oracle JDeveloper是一个免费的集成开发环境,它简化了基于Java EE的复合应用程序的开发,并提供了完整的端到端...

3
10Duke SDK
10Duke SDK是用于创建新的在线应用程序的快速应用程序开发(RAD)套件;它提供了一组模块化的,可重用的库,旨在满足在线应用程序的挑战性要求。
- 付费应用
- Windows
- Mac
- Linux
- Web
- Self-Hosted

3

2

1
AdoptOpenJDK
Java的代码是开源的,可在OpenJDK™上获得。AdoptOpenJDK通过完全开源的构建脚本和基础架构集提供预构建的OpenJDK二进制文件。在Docker Hub上获取Docker映像。夜间活动可以在存档中找到。

0
Spring Roo
Spring Roo是面向Java开发人员的下一代快速应用程序开发工具。使用Roo,您可以在几分钟内轻松构建完整的Java应用程序。